Goodwill needs you to clear the clutter from your closets and donate your gently-used clothing and other household items. The sales of your donations help fund job training programs, employment placement services and other community-based programs for people who have disabilities, lack education or job experience, or face employment challenges.

Due to hazardous material disposal laws, Goodwill cannot accept non-working refrigerators, air conditioners, or any other item that may contain Freon. We cannot accept bulb-type televisions that contain cathode ray tubes or picture tubes; we can only accept flat screen televisions. We also cannot accept live ammunition, firearms, paint, old tires or medical treatment items, such as syringes and oxygen tanks. Due to the possibility of mold, mildew, infestations and contamination, please do not donate items such as mattresses, box springs, soiled or wet clothing. THANKS!
